The next killer in Dead by Daylight is known. A true classic of Japanese horror is coming to the asymmetrical killer game.

In Dead by Daylight, an event with plenty of snowmen and bonus rewards is currently taking place, but the developers are already giving a glimpse into the coming year. In a first teaser, it has been shown which franchise they have collaborated with. Fans of Japanese horror are sure to get their money’s worth.

What has been released? The trailer makes it unmistakably clear that Behaviour has secured the rights to “Ringu.” In the horror story, it centers around a video cassette with a mysterious film. Those who watch the film in its entirety are cursed and plagued by phone calls in the following days before they die exactly 7 years later.

The origin of the curse is the supernatural Sadako Yamamura, who lies at the bottom of a well.

In “Ringu,” the only way to escape the curse is to show the video to another person – who will then be cursed instead.

Isn’t “Ringu” the same as “Ring”? Basically yes. Here in the West, most people associate “Ring” with the 2002 film. However, that is actually a remake of the original Japanese from 1998 “Ring – The Original.” The original is generally considered darker than the remake, but uses fewer special effects. In Germany, the original film “Ringu” flew a bit under the radar, partly due to the poor dubbing.

The chapter in Dead by Daylight is based on the Japanese “Ringu” film and the book by Koji Suzuki.

What can the killer do? That is still completely unclear. In “Ring,” the murders occur after victims have watched a cursed video. 7 days after viewing the film, the viewers die and are plagued by mysterious phone calls until then. At the center of the film is the video cassette with the curse.

It is quite conceivable that the killer possesses an object that must be passed around like a “hot potato” from survivor to survivor to escape the curse. Others speculate that the phone ringing could be related to the killer’s power, as it is also heard in the trailer.

Concrete information will likely only come in February or March 2022, as new killers are usually playable on the test server only about 2 weeks before release.

When is the chapter coming? The “Ringu” chapter will not arrive until March 2022, which will be the next big chapter of the horror game. That Dead by Daylight announces a chapter so early is a bit unusual. Usually, these announcements are made only a few weeks before release. This way, horror fans already get a little glimpse and can look forward to what happens in 2022.
